However, near Tower Lake, the existing floodplain extends approximately <br />300 feet beyond the 1977 FHAO. <br /> <br />I <br /> <br />I <br /> <br />Upstream of l04th A venue, between stations 625+00 to 603+00, the west bank FHAD floodplain is approximately <br />200 feet narrower than the previous floodplain. As with several of the differences already described, this is a <br />relatively flat area, and small changes in water surface elevations can result in substantial changes in floodplain <br />extent. Although the Master Plan model used a split flow analysis in the vicinity of 104th A venue, this study <br />modeled the area as divided flows because it was determined that there were multiple hydraulic connections <br />between the main channel and the east overbank. <br /> <br />The floodplain extending from Franklin Street to 1-270 is significantly wider than the previous FHAD. Here, the <br />existing floodplain flows into an area that previously was not floodplain. In April 1998, when the aerial <br />photography used for this study was updated, construction was in progress in this area, resulting in this area being <br />added to the floodplain. The west overbank in this area was modeled as a split flow reach using Denver FHAD <br />split flows (UDFCO 1985b). Upstream of 1-270, between stations 969+00 to 962+00, the FHAD floodplain extends <br />roughly 350 feet further west than that in the previous FHAD. The change in water surface elevations between the <br />two models is less than one foot in this area. The revised floodplain delineation is within the National Map <br />Accuracy Standards (:I: 1 foot). The revised water surface elevation lies on the other side of the elevation contour <br />line compared to the Master Plan water surface elevation; therefore, the resultant floodplain is slightly different. <br />The difference in extent (350 feet) is attributable to the lack of topographic relief in this area. <br /> <br />Section 4 <br />Hydraulic Analyses <br /> <br />I <br /> <br />I <br /> <br />Downstream of Henderson Road, the construction of the E-470 Bridge has significantly altered the shape of the <br />floodplain. The bridge was designed to fully pass the 100-year flood flows and thus the floodplain has been <br />narrowed at this spot. Due to the construction of the bridge and associated earthwork, the topography in this area <br />has been altered. The floodplain was mapped based on the LOMR data, not based on the mapping used as the <br />basis for this FHAO. <br /> <br />Upstream of 1-76, between stations 905+00 to 900+00, the FHAD floodplain extends roughly 1,400 feet east of the <br />main channel, whereas the previous floodplain does not. There is a narrow swale, approximately 30 feet wide in <br />this area, which allows water to flow into the topographically depressed area east of the main channel. The <br />algorithm used to generate the previous FHAO floodplain did not account for this hydraulic connection, and <br />excluded this area from the floodplain. <br /> <br />I <br /> <br />;1 <br /> <br />II <br /> <br />Upstream of the Brighton split flow reach (station 290+00 to 250+00) the west FHAO floodplain is approximately <br />300 feet narrower than the Master Plan floodplain. The east bank FHAD floodplain (station 275+00 to 260+00) <br />extends approximately 150 feet further than the Master Plan floodplain. Oownstream of the Brighton Ditch <br />diversion, the 100-year floodplain shows similar results as the 1977 FHAD. The existing floodplain matches the <br />1977 floodplain with minor exceptions. These exceptions occur along both sides, with the current floodplain <br />boundary lying within the 1977 boundary. <br /> <br />Immediately upstream and downstream of the Highway 224 Bridge (station 885+00 to 887+50) the FHAO <br />floodplain is approximately 400 ft narrower than the floodplain shown on the previous FHAD. This appears to be a <br />result of topographical changes to the area, notably the filling of a former gravel pit. <br /> <br />Downstream of Engineers Lake to 88th A venue, the 100-year floodplain is significantly wider than that shown on <br />the 1977 FHAD, but similar to that shown on the 1995 Flood Insurance Rate Map (FIRM) for Adams County and <br />Incorporated Areas. Along the west side of this reach, West Gravel Lake No.3 is now included in the floodplain. <br />Differences in the immediate vicinity of 88th Avenue can be attributed to the different model algorithms used for <br />predicting water surface elevations at bridges. In addition, this area was modeled as a split flow in the previous <br />FHAD, but was modeled as a single reach in this study <br /> <br />'I <br /> <br />I <br /> <br />I <br /> <br />The existing 100-year floodplain downstream of 88th Avenue to Fulton Ditch is similar to the previous FHAD with <br />differences occurring primarily along the west side, where development and degradation on the channel bed has <br />reduced the extent of the floodplain. Further floodplain reductions under existing conditions were observed <br />southeast of the intersection of McKay Road and 96th Avenue. The floodplain has expanded slightly near McKay <br />Road, where the eastern embankments north and south of McKay Road are overtopped under existing conditions <br />while the 1977 FHAD shows these areas to be dry. <br /> <br />I <br /> <br />From Fulton Ditch to Brantner Ditch, the 100-year floodplain matches the 1977 FHAO floodplain with one <br />exception. The west side of the reach starting at approximately the Fulton Ditch headgate has increased flooding. <br />This occurs over 104th A venue and into a gravel pond and extends north to the Grange Hall Creek outfalL The rest <br />of the reach closely matches the 1977 FHAD floodplain boundary. <br /> <br />I <br /> <br />I <br /> <br />North of Brantner Ditch to Henderson Road has two distinct differences occurring, one along the west side and the <br />other along the east. The west side has experienced an increase in floodplain extent while the east side has been <br />reduced. Inside the floodplain, additional islands have formed, mainly due to the formation of new gravel ponds <br />in the area. <br /> <br />I <br /> <br />Significant changes in the 100-year floodplain have occurred around Henderson Road. North of Henderson Road <br />on the west side of the reach, the Riverdale Dunes Golf Course has been constructed. This has created a reduced, <br />discontinuous floodplain resembling a braided channel.
